KINGS OF MACEDON. Philip III Arrhidaios, 323-317 BC. Drachm (Silver, 17 mm, 4.23 g, 5 h), Abydos, struck under Leonnatos, Arrhidaios, or Antigonos I Monophthalmos. Head of Herakles to right, wearing lion skin headdress. Rev. ΦIΛIΠΠOY Zeus seated left on low throne, holding long scepter in his left hand and eagle standing right with closed wings in his right; to left, branch; below throne, horse leg. ADM II Series, VIII, 124-5. Price -. Very fine.
